The Independent Pricing and Regulatory Tribunal of NSW (IPART) has two ongoing roles under the amended Biofuels Act:

  1. to determine, and periodically review, a ‘reasonable wholesale price’ (wholesale price) for ethanol for use in the production of petrol-ethanol blends such as E10, and
  2. to monitor the retail market (including prices) for petrol-ethanol blend and make reports to the Minister for Innovation and Better Regulation (the Minister) on the effect of a determination of the reasonable price for wholesale ethanol

This report presents our draft findings on the retail market for E10, along with our draft findings on the wholesale ethanol market and the form of price regulation needed in that market.
